Fans should now simply select that book and click on the "do homework" button to cause the Sim to move to a table and begin their studies. For full clarity, a Sim's personal inventory is visualized as a file box that appears in the bottom-right corner of the screen, and there will be a blue book within it. Players that are attempting to do homework in The Sims 4's High School Years expansion should look in the personal inventory of their teenage Sims.
